[AJUDA]Criar comando no chekpoint.
#1

Olha queria uma comando /consertar (veiculo)
Pra funcionar num checkpoint nessa cordenadas
(217,1063.4186,-1772.5121,14.3709,191.3302,0,0,0,0,0,0);
(217,1071.7729,-1772.5527,14.3787,268.0016,0,0,0,0,0,0);
Deis de ja obrigado (:
Reply
#2

pawn Код:
if(!strcmp(cmdtext,"/consertar",true))
{
if(IsPlayerInRangeOfPoint(playerid,5,1071.7729,-1772.5527,14.3787))
{
// aqui coloca o resto do comando...
return 1;
}
}
Se nгo funcionar fale que eu corrijo (:
Reply
#3

pawn Код:
public OnPlayerEnterRaceCheckpoint(playerid)
{
    if(IsPlayerInRangeOfPoint(playerid,5.0,1071.7729,-1772.5527,14.3787))
    {
        RepairVehicle(GetPlayerVehicleID(playerid));
        SendClientMessage(playerid, -1, "Veiculo reparado!");
    }
    if(IsPlayerInRangeOfPoint(playerid,5.0, 1063.4186,-1772.5121,14.3709))
    {
        RepairVehicle(GetPlayerVehicleID(playerid));
        SendClientMessage(playerid, -1, "Veiculo reparado!");
    }
    return 1;
}
tenta
Reply
#4

Boa ai mais tipo queria um que gastasse grana eo checkpoint alquem sabe fazer?(servidor rp)
Reply
#5

para gastar grana sу colocar.

Код:
GivePlayerMoney(playerid, -PRECODOREPARO);
Para colocar o checkpoint sу usar isso

Код:
SetPlayerCheckpoint(playerid, 217,1063.4186,-1772.5121,14.3709, 3.0);
SetPlayerCheckpoint(playerid, 217,1071.7729,-1772.5527,14.3787, 3.0);
Reply
#6

PHP код:
if(!strcmp(cmdtext,"/consertar",true))
{
if(
IsPlayerInRangeOfPoint(playerid,5,1071.7729,-1772.5527,14.3787))
{
SetVehicleHealth(GetPlayerVehicleID(playerid),1000.0);
GivePlayerMoney(playerid, -100);//troca o 100 pelo preзo que vc que
return 1;
}

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)